It's all quite complicated, i can tell you what we have to do.
My hubby is a motor mechanic and is on the occupation in demand list, so we are able to go over to Oz on the 'general skilled' application. Before you can apply on this application you have to have your skills assessed, for us it was Trade Recognition Australia.
We got all our info from www.immi.gov.au which is the official site.
My sister was in a similar situation, she used a migration agent, i can't tell you the number of times i have had to ask her for help.
Best is to have a look on the website and then see if you need an agent....
We have paid $300 TRA, $1990 for application and then there are medicals which i believe to cost quite a lot aswell.
